Question
Ate a dairy meal and after an hour wants to eat meat, is it necessary to perform 'kinuach and hadacha' [i.e., eat a solid food and rinse the mouth with water] before eating the meat?
Answer
There is a disagreement between the Taz and the Shach, and practically, it is not required.
Source
Shulchan Aruch, Yoreh De'ah, Siman 89
